Q: Is 897,959 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 897,959 is not a prime number.

Why is 897,959 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 897959 can be evenly divided by 1 19 167 283 3,173 5,377 47,261 and 897,959, with no remainder.

Since 897,959 cannot be divided by just 1 and 897,959, it is not a prime number.
